The time, T (seconds) it takes for a pot of water to boil is inversely proportional to the cooker setting, H, applied to the pot. When H = 8, T = 120. Work out T when H = 10
Answer:
T = 96
Step-by-step explanation:
From the question given above, we were told that the time, T (seconds) it takes for a pot of water to boil is inversely proportional to the cooker setting, H. This can be written as:
T ∝ 1/H
T = K/H
Cross multiply
K = TH
Next, we shall determine the value of K. This can be obtained as follow:
H = 8
T = 120
K =?
K = TH
K = 120 × 8
K = 960
Finally, we shall determine the value of T when H = 10. This can be obtained as illustrated below:
H = 10
K = 960
T =.?
T = K/H
T = 960/10
T = 96

Find the equation of the line that contains the point (-4, -4) and is perpendicular to the line 4x + 5y = 5. Write the line in slope-intercept form, if possible.
Answer:
y = 5/4x + 1
Step-by-step explanation:
4x + 5y = 5
5y = -4x + 5
y = -4/5x + 1
Perpendicular slope: 5/4
(-4, -4)
Slope-intercept:
y - y1 = m(x - x1)
y + 4 = 5/4(x + 4)
y + 4 = 5/4x + 5
y = 5/4x + 1

If 50-3x=x-26, then x=
Answer:
x=19
Step-by-step explanation:
50 - 3x = x -26
50-3x-50=x-26-50
-3x=x-76
-3x-x=x-76-x
-4x= -76
x= -76/-4
x=19
